The Macaron Baker – Free Crochet Pattern

This lovely cream-colored rabbit features tall, perky ears and a gentle expression. She is dressed in a magnificent tiered dress that resembles a tower of macarons, featuring layers of Baby Pink, Mint Green, and Lilac Purple. Covering her shoulders is a delicate, lacy white bolero jacket that adds an air of refinement.




She steps out in dainty lilac ballet flats. Her accessories are just as sweet: she holds a giant strawberry macaron, carries a luxurious cylindrical gift box, and is accompanied by a pristine white Poodle with a fluffy, aristocratic coat. A small macaron hair clip (optional) adds the final touch to her ensemble. This pattern is designed for intermediate crocheters who love playing with color changes and creating texture.

Abbreviations (US Terms)

  • MR – Magic Ring
  • ch – Chain
  • sc – Single Crochet
  • hdc – Half Double Crochet
  • dc – Double Crochet
  • tr – Treble Crochet
  • sl st – Slip Stitch
  • inc – Increase (2 sc in one stitch)
  • dec – Decrease (sc 2 stitches together)
  • st(s) – Stitch(es)
  • rnd – Round
  • row – Row
  • BLO – Back Loop Only
  • FLO – Front Loop Only
  • Bobble St – (Yarn over, insert hook, pull up loop, pull through 2) x 5, yarn over pull through all loops.
  • FO – Fasten Off

Materials Needed

  • DK weight yarn in Cream (Rabbit)
  • DK weight yarn in Pastel Pink, Mint Green, Lilac (Dress Tiers)
  • DK weight yarn in White (Bolero, Poodle, Macaron filling)
  • DK weight yarn in Lilac (Shoes)
  • Sport weight yarn or thread for the Gift Box details (Gold/Multi-color)
  • 2.5 mm crochet hook (for amigurumi parts)
  • 3.0 mm crochet hook (for clothing)
  • Pair of 10mm black safety eyes (Rabbit)
  • Pair of 6mm black safety eyes (Poodle)
  • Pink embroidery thread (Nose)
  • Fiberfill stuffing
  • Yarn needle, scissors, stitch markers, pins
  • Cardboard (for shoe soles and box base)

Gauge & Finished Size

Work tightly in continuous spiral rounds for the rabbit body so the stuffing does not show. Using DK yarn and a 2.5mm hook, the finished rabbit stands approximately 30 cm (12 inches) tall including ears.

Construction Overview

The rabbit is constructed in pieces. The legs are made first and joined to form the body. The head is a modified sphere. The dress is the showstopper: it is worked from the waist down with a base layer, and three ruffled tiers are attached to the front loops. The lace bolero is worked flat. The poodle uses bobble stitches for texture.

Body Parts (Rabbit)

Legs (Make 2)

Use Cream yarn.

  • Rnd 1: MR, 6 sc.
  • Rnd 2: inc around (12).
  • Rnd 3: (1 sc, inc) around (18).
  • Rnd 4–6: sc around (18).
  • Rnd 7: (4 sc, dec) around (15).
  • Rnd 8–22: sc around (15).

Stuff firmly. FO first leg. Do not cut yarn on second leg.

Body

Join legs: From second leg, ch 3, join to first leg with sc.

  • Rnd 23: sc 15 (leg 1), sc 3 in ch, sc 15 (leg 2), sc 3 in ch (36).
  • Rnd 24: (5 sc, inc) repeat around (42).
  • Rnd 25–30: sc around (42).
  • Rnd 31: (5 sc, dec) repeat around (36).
  • Rnd 32–34: sc around (36).
  • Rnd 35: (4 sc, dec) repeat around (30).
  • Rnd 36–38: sc around (30).
  • Rnd 39: (3 sc, dec) repeat around (24).
  • Rnd 40: sc around (24).
  • Rnd 41: (2 sc, dec) repeat around (18).

Stuff firmly. FO. Leave tail for head.

Head

Use Cream yarn.

  • Rnd 1: MR, 6 sc.
  • Rnd 2: inc around (12).
  • Rnd 3: (1 sc, inc) around (18).
  • Rnd 4: (2 sc, inc) around (24).
  • Rnd 5: (3 sc, inc) around (30).
  • Rnd 6: (4 sc, inc) around (36).
  • Rnd 7: (5 sc, inc) around (42).
  • Rnd 8: (6 sc, inc) around (48).
  • Rnd 9: (7 sc, inc) around (54).
  • Rnd 10–21: sc around (54).
  • Rnd 22: (7 sc, dec) around (48).
  • Rnd 23: (6 sc, dec) around (42).
  • Rnd 24: (5 sc, dec) around (36).




Insert safety eyes between Rnds 16 and 17, spaced 10 stitches apart. Embroider a Y-shaped nose.

  • Rnd 25: (4 sc, dec) around (30).
  • Rnd 26: (3 sc, dec) around (24).
  • Rnd 27: (2 sc, dec) around (18).

Stuff firmly. FO.

Ears (Make 2)

Use Cream yarn.

  • Rnd 1: MR, 6 sc.
  • Rnd 2: inc around (12).
  • Rnd 3: (1 sc, inc) around (18).
  • Rnd 4: (2 sc, inc) around (24).
  • Rnd 5–10: sc around.
  • Rnd 11: (6 sc, dec) around (21).
  • Rnd 12–14: sc around.
  • Rnd 15: (5 sc, dec) around (18).
  • Rnd 16–20: sc around.
  • Rnd 21: (4 sc, dec) around (15).
  • Rnd 22–24: sc around.

Flatten and sew to top of head.

Arms (Make 2)

Use Cream yarn.

  • Rnd 1: MR, 6 sc.
  • Rnd 2: inc around (12).
  • Rnd 3–15: sc around (12).

Stuff lightly. Flatten and sew to body.

The Pastel Wardrobe

Tiered Macaron Dress

Use 3.0mm hook. The skirt is built on a mesh base, with ruffles attached to front loops.

  • Waist/Bodice Base: Use Lilac. Ch 36. Join. sc around (36).
  • Rnd 2: (BLO) sc around (36). (Attach skirt here).
  • Rnd 3–8: sc around (Bodice).
  • Straps: Ch 15 from corners. Sew to back.
  • Skirt Base: Join to BLO of Rnd 2. Work (sc, ch 2, skip 1) around. Spiral down for length of skirt (approx 15 rnds of mesh).
  • Tier 1 (Top – Pink): Join Pink yarn to FLO of Rnd 2.
    Rnd 1: (inc) around (72).
    Rnd 2–4: dc around. FO.
  • Tier 2 (Middle – Mint): Join Mint yarn to the mesh base about 1 inch below the pink tier.
    Rnd 1: (inc) around mesh loops.
    Rnd 2–4: dc around. FO.
  • Tier 3 (Bottom – Lilac): Join Lilac yarn to the mesh base about 1 inch below the mint tier.
    Rnd 1: (inc) around.
    Rnd 2–4: dc around. FO.

White Lace Bolero

Use White yarn and 3.0mm hook. Worked flat.

  • Row 1: Ch 30. sc across (29).
  • Row 2: (inc) across (58).
  • Row 3: *Ch 3, skip 1, sc* across (Lace loops).
  • Row 4 (Armholes): Work lace pattern over 8 sts, ch 6 (skip 12), work lace over 18 sts, ch 6 (skip 12), work lace over 8 sts.
  • Row 5–8: Work *Ch 3, sc in loop* across.
  • Row 9: Scallop edge: 5 dc in each loop. FO.

Lilac Shoes (Make 2)

Use Lilac yarn.

  • Rnd 1: Ch 8. Oval start: sc 6, 3 sc in last, sc 5, inc (16).
  • Rnd 2: inc, sc 5, 3 inc, sc 5, 2 inc (22).
  • Rnd 3: (BLO) sc around (22).
  • Rnd 4: sc around.
  • Rnd 5: sc 7, 4 dec, sc 7 (18).
  • Rnd 6: Ch 6 (strap), skip 6, sl st. FO.

Confectionery Accessories

Giant Macaron (Handheld)

Use Pink and White yarn.

  • Shells (Make 2 Pink):
    Rnd 1: MR 6 sc.
    Rnd 2: inc around (12).
    Rnd 3: (1 sc, inc) around (18).
    Rnd 4: (2 sc, inc) around (24).
    Rnd 5: (3 sc, inc) around (30).
    Rnd 6: (BLO) sc around (30).
    Rnd 7: sc around. FO.
  • Filling (White):
    Rnd 1: MR 6 sc.
    Rnd 2: inc around (12).
    Rnd 3: (1 sc, inc) around (18).
    Rnd 4: (2 sc, inc) around (24).
    Rnd 5: (3 sc, inc) around (30). FO.
  • Assembly: Sandwich the white circle between the two pink shells. Sew together through the loops. Stuff lightly.

Small Macaron Clip

Follow the Giant Macaron pattern but stop increasing at Rnd 3 (18 sts). Sew to a small metal hair clip or bobby pin.

Luxury Gift Box

Use Lilac/White/Striped yarn.

  • Base: MR 6, inc to 12… continue increasing to 42 sts.
  • Sides: (BLO) sc around (42). Work 10 rounds stripes.
  • Lid: Make a circle slightly larger (48 sts). Work 2 rounds sc.
  • Decorate with a ribbon bow on top.

Poodle Companion

Use White yarn.

  • Head: MR 6, inc to 12.
    Rnd 3: *sc, Bobble St* around (curly top).
    Rnd 4–6: sc around (Face).
    Rnd 7: dec around. Stuff. Close.
  • Body: MR 6, inc to 12.
    Rnd 3–6: *sc, Bobble St* around.
    Rnd 7: dec around. Stuff. Close.
  • Ears: Ch 4, Bobble in 4th. Sew to head.
  • Legs: Ch 4, Bobble in 4th. Make 4. Sew to body.

Assembly

  1. Dress the rabbit in the Tiered Dress.
  2. Put on the Lilac Shoes.
  3. Drape the Lace Bolero over her shoulders.
  4. Stitch the Giant Macaron under one arm.
  5. Clip the small Macaron to her ear (optional).
  6. Place the Gift Box and Poodle by her side.




Your Macaron Baker Rabbit is ready to serve the sweetest treats! Bon Appétit.
